澳门新葡萄京娱乐场配置PHP5.3.3+Apache2.2.16+MySQL5.1.49

忙了一成天都未有收获,顿然想起看一下appserv的安排文件,果然通过了。欢愉中。。。记下来先。使用软件版本:apache_2.2.6-win32-x86-openssl-0.9.8e.msimysql-5.0.45-win32.exephp-5.2.5-Win32.zipphpMyAdmin-2.11.2.2-all-languages.zip1.装置apache到d:serverapache2.22.设置MySQL到d:servermysql53.解压php到d:serverphp4.拷贝php文件夹下的libmysql.dll到c:windowssystem32目录下;5.拷贝php文件夹下的php.ini-recommended到c:windows下并改名换姓为php.ini——————————————————————–6.打开apache的安排文件
a.在有相当多LoadModule处加多一行: LoadModule php5_module
d:/Serverphpphp5apache2_2.dll b.改正DocumentRoot e:/www
那是放置网页的根目录,自身想设置在哪些地点就安装在哪些地方。 c.# This
should be changed to whatever you set DocumentRoot to. Directory e:/www
找到这里之后,把原本Directory 中的路线改成和b一样的门径。
d.在DirectoryIndex index.html处增加index.htm index.php
e.最后在IfModule/IfModule附近加多再增加一段 IfModule mod_php5.c AddType
application/x- .php AddType application/x- .php3 AddType application/x-
.phps
/IfModule————————————————————————7.展开在c:windows下的php.ini文件
a.将须臾间语句前的;符号去掉 extension=php_dbase.dll
extension=php_gd2.dll extension=php_mbstring.dll
extension=php_mysql.dll extension=php_mysqli.dll
extension=php_sockets.dll&nbs

转:

一 准备 
1 下载apache
httpd-2.2.22-win32-x86-openssl-0.9.8t.msi 

 

openssl代表带有openssl模块,利用openssl可给Apache配置SSL安全链接 

首先步:下载安装的文件
    1.
MySQL:下载地址mysql-5.1.49-win32.msi;
    2. Apache:
下载地址httpd-2.2.16-win32-x86-openssl-0.9.8o.msi澳门新葡萄京娱乐场,;
    3. PHP5.3.3 
下载地址php-5.3.3-Win32-VC6-x86在意:必须求下载php-5.3.3-Win32-VC6-x86版本
   
的,不要下载php-5.3.3-nts-Win32-VC6-x86本子,更不要下载VC9版本的,因为她是IIS服务器安装版本。
其次步:安装文件
    1.
在要安装的磁盘建一个文件夹(我的做法是在D盘的根目录下创办叁个php文件夹D:php)。
    2. 装置Apache服务器,安装达成后的目录结果是:D:phpApache。
    3. 把下载的php-5.3.3-Win32-VC6-x86解压的D:php目录中,能够把文件夹的名字改短,结果D:phpphp5
    4.
安装MySql数据库,它的安装和平日情况相符。小编把他设置在(D:phpMySQL)和php同目录。
第三步:配置PHP5.3.3
    1.
配备PHP5.3.3,张开php安装目录(我是D:phpphp5)能够观望目录下有七个那样的文本php.ini-   
development和php.ini-production,第多少个是开拓应用的安排文件,第二个是正统的生育碰到的铺排。
    2. 采撷php.ini-development复制一份到同目录下,并更名字为php.ini使用文本工具张开,查找extension_dir,可以
        见到八个,选取On
windows:下面包车型地铁百般并去得眼下的支行更改为extension_dir =
“D:/php/php5/ext”,读者根
       
据自身的目录构造构造,目标是找到和php.ini同目录下的ext文件夹中的扩展库。
    3. 查找extension=php_,去掉extension=php_curl.dll、extension=php_gd2.dll、extension=php_mbstring.dll、
       
extension=php_mysql.dll、extension=php_mysqli.dll、extension=php_pdo_mysql.dll、extension=php_xmlrpc.dll前面
        的分号。查找short_open_tag = Off把它改革成short_open_tag =
On,让其接济短标签。
    4.
复制php5ts.dll文件到WINDOWS/system32目录下,唯有php-5.3.3-Win32-VC6-x86本子中才有php5ts.dll
        php-5.3.3-nts-Win32-VC6-x86版本是还没的。

2 下载php
php-5.3.5-Win32-VC6-x86.zip 

    5.
如何无法连接收mysql,把php的libmysql.dll也复制到c:/windows/system32/下。
第四步:配置Apache
    1.
展开Apache目录下conf目录中的httpd.conf文件,查找#LoadModule,在其末尾处大概是128行之处
        添加:
        LoadModule php5_module
“D:/php/php5/php5apache2_2.dll”
        PHPIniDir “D:/php/php5”
        AddType application/x-httpd-php .php
        AddType application/x-httpd-php .htm
        AddType application/x-httpd-php .html
        目录构造依据客商自个儿目录配置。
    2. 查找DirectoryIndex index.html
将其校正成DirectoryIndex index.php
default.php index.html index.htm default.html
        default.htm
    3. 搜索DocumentRoot将其改革为指向您供给停放web文件的文本夹上(作者在D:/php目录中创制了二个
        www文件夹)所以DocumentRoot就是DocumentRoot
“D:/php/www”,读者能够依靠本身布置来修改。
    4. 探索<Directory将其修正为你和睦安排的DocumentRoot的路径(笔者是<Directory “D:/php/www”>)
第五步:测验php+Apache+MySql是还是不是配备成功
    1.
开垦MySql在MySql中开创一个新数据库和表。(小编是userInfo数据库和users表就有id和name四个字段)
        测量检验呢?轻便就好,呵呵!!
    2.
在上头成立的www文件夹中开创贰个index.php文件使用艾德itPlus或然别的文件工具展开。
    3. 写入:

下载vc6版本 
VC6:legacy Visual Studio 6 compiler,正是使用这么些编写翻译器编写翻译的。 

Php代码
澳门新葡萄京娱乐场 1

VC9:the Visual Studio 二〇〇九 compiler,正是用微软的VS编辑器编写翻译的。 

  1. <?   
  2.     $DB_HOST = “localhost”;   
  3.     $DB_USER = “root”;   
  4.     $DB_PASS = “root”;   
  5.     $DB_NAME = “userInfo”;   
  6.   
  7.     mysql_connect($DB_HOST,$DB_USER,$DB_PASS);
      
  8.     mysql_select_db($DB_NAME);   
  9.        
  10.     mysql_query(“set NAMES gb2312”);   
  11.     $sql = “Select * From users”;   
  12.     $result = mysql_query($sql);   
  13.     while($data=mysql_fetch_array($result)){   
  14.         echo “————————“;   
  15.         echo $data[‘id’].”<br/>”;   
  16.         echo $data[‘name’].”<br/>”;   
  17.     }   
  18.     mysql_close();   
  19. ?>  

    $DB_HOST = "localhost";
    $DB_USER = "root";
    $DB_PASS = "root";
    $DB_NAME = "userInfo";
    
    mysql_connect($DB_HOST,$DB_USER,$DB_PASS);
    mysql_select_db($DB_NAME);
    
    mysql_query("set NAMES gb2312");
    $sql = "Select * From users";
    $result = mysql_query($sql);
    while($data=mysql_fetch_array($result)){
        echo "------------------------";
        echo $data['id']."<br/>";
        echo $data['name']."<br/>";
    }
    mysql_close();
    

    ?>

3 下载mysql
 

4.起步Apache服务器,在浏览器输入
        即便看见下图:表示我们功到自然成了!祝贺祝贺!

二 安装 
1 apache 比较容易,一路next达成. 

      澳门新葡萄京娱乐场 2

澳门新葡萄京娱乐场 3

浏览器验证,现身转手页面,成功

澳门新葡萄京娱乐场 4

2 php安装

下载zip包,直接解压到二个索引,目录重命名称叫php

澳门新葡萄京娱乐场 5

3 mysql 
略 
三 配置 
php配置 
php.ini-development 文件重命名叫 php.ini 
点名PHP增添包的切实可行目录,以便调用相应的DLL文件 

复制代码代码如下:

; Directory in which the loadable extensions (modules) reside. 
;  
; extension_dir = “./” 
; On windows: 
; extension_dir = “ext” 

修改为 

复制代码代码如下:

; Directory in which the loadable extensions (modules) reside. 
;  
; extension_dir = “./” 
; On windows: 
extension_dir = “D:/servers/php/ext” 

撤消以下配置注释,扶持mysql 

复制代码代码如下:

extension=php_curl.dll 
extension=php_gd2.dll 
extension=php_mysql.dll 
extension=php_pdo_mysql.dll 
extension=php_pdo_odbc.dll 

支持session 
session.save_path = “e:/temp” 
上传文件目录配置 
upload_tmp_dir =”e:/temp” 
时区配置 
date.timezone =Asia/Shanghai 

apache配置 
在#LoadModule vhost_alias_module modules/mod_vhost_alias.so下添加 

复制代码代码如下:

LoadModule php5_module “e:/servers/php/php5apache2_2.dll” 
PHPIniDir “e:/servers/php” 
AddType application/x-httpd-php .php .html .htm 

web主目录校订 

复制代码代码如下:

DocumentRoot “D:/servers/Apache2.2/htdocs” 

改为 

复制代码代码如下:

DocumentRoot “D:/servers/phpweb” 

 

复制代码代码如下:

<Directory “D:/servers/Apache2.2/htdocs”> 

改为 

复制代码代码如下:

<Directory “D:/phpweb”> 

 

复制代码代码如下:

<IfModule dir_module> 
DirectoryIndex index.html 
</IfModule> 

改为 

复制代码代码如下:

<IfModule dir_module> 
DirectoryIndex index.php index.html 
</IfModule> 

重启apache 

mysql配置 
略 
四 测试 
建立phpweb目录 D:serversphpweb 

创建测量试验文件 index.php 

复制代码代码如下:

<?php 
phpinfo(); 
?> 

浏览: 
来得如下消息,表明配置成功: 

澳门新葡萄京娱乐场 6

创设mysql连接测量试验文件 

复制代码代码如下:

<?php 
$connect=mysql_connect(“10.71.196.147″,”user”,””); 
if(!$connect) echo “Mysql Connect Error!”; 
else echo “mysql 连接成功”; 
mysql_close(); 
?> 

发表评论

电子邮件地址不会被公开。 必填项已用*标注